The challenge
Iron Club had grown to 1,200 members by 2024 but was still tracking everything in Excel and a WhatsApp group.
Each month, 12-15% of members would lapse on their renewal — sometimes because they forgot, sometimes because they couldn't reach the owner to pay, and sometimes because no one followed up.
Rohan was spending two evenings a week on collections calls, and his front-desk staff had no visibility into which members were due.
What they did
- Migrated 1,200 members from Excel to Kasratbook in a single weekend.
- Set up UPI autopay mandates so 73% of members opted into recurring payments at the next renewal.
- Configured a 5-step WhatsApp reminder sequence: 10 days, 3 days, day-of, day-3-after, day-7-after.
- Trained the front-desk staff to use the daily collections dashboard — every morning starts with a list of members due that day.
The outcome
- Recovered ₹2.1 lakh in missed renewals in the first calendar month, mostly from members who'd lapsed in the previous 2 months.
- Renewal rate climbed from 78% to 92% over six months.
- Rohan's personal collections time dropped from ~12 hours a week to roughly an hour.
- Membership has grown 22% YoY because retention is no longer the bottleneck.
